Hello, The Wings Are Playing Too!
KK Hockey — ... of Wrigley’s ice) indicate as much. A clip from NBC Chicago captures an unnamed NHL employee describing the game at hand thusly: “This year we’ve got the resurgent Hawks, which are just a fantastic story...In the world of sports, for that matter, and they’re playing their arch rival, the defending Stanley Cup champions, and it’s really shaping up to be a fierce, fierce day of hockey.” Note that the Red Wings weren’t even mentioned by name.
